This role is responsible for performing the duties of an Aircraft Logs and Records Clerk. The specialist will update, maintain, and verify various technical directive system lists and reports, as well as maintain and upkeep TRACE CADPAD Modules for aircraft and ejection seats AESR Records. Key tasks include drafting engine transaction reports, end-of-quarter engine reports, OPNAV XRAY and quarterly aircraft audit reports, and operating NALCOMIS OOMA for NAVFLIR data entry. The position also involves compiling the Monthly Maintenance Plan, submitting required CDRLs, and maintaining OOMA component Auto Log-Sets (ALS) with installation and usage data. The specialist will monitor aircraft configuration status, weight and balance, and inventory data for accuracy, and maintain the depot event induction/receipt schedule with necessary pre-induction reports. A crucial part of the role is reviewing NALCOMIS OOMA Auto Log-Set (ALS) maintenance documents to ensure program requirements are met, and coordinating with PMO, customers, and work centers on aircraft history/logbook matters. The role also includes providing technical assistance, maintaining work area cleanliness, adhering to Foreign Object Damage (FOD) prevention rules, and following the Company Tool Control Program.
